There are a few things you can do if the citroen's key fob has stopped working. It could be due to a dropped object that has damaged the internal chip or it could have simply stopped working.

You must first examine the battery of your key fob. This is usually the cause of numerous of the issues listed in the previous paragraphs, since a depleted or dead battery can stop the key fob from sending its signals to the receiver module in the car. Replacing the battery is relatively simple and can be done at home. Check for any water damage to the key fob since this could cause it to cease functioning. Once you've replaced the battery, re-installing the key fob inside the ignition can help restore its function. It is also an excellent idea to test all the buttons on the key fob to test both lock and unlock functions.

The key fob's battery warning symbol on your dashboard could indicate that the battery in the key fob have very low levels. They will need to be changed. This is easy and can be done at the side of the road as most keys can be pried open to allow the replacement batteries to go in. They are typically the CR2025 or CR2032 3-Volt batteries that are available at most electronics stores. Refer to the owner's manual of your device for the specifics or YouTube videos on how to use this.
